美国传统词典[双解]


blame

blame

AHD:[bl3m]

D.J.[bleim]

K.K.[blem]

v.tr.(及物动词)

blamedblam.ingblames

(1)To hold responsible.

负责

(2)To find fault with; censure.

指责:找…的差错;指责,谴责

(3)To place responsibility for (something):

归咎:把(某事)责任归于…:

blamed the crisis on poor planning.

把危机归咎于计划不周

n.(名词)

(1)The state of being responsible for a fault or an error; culpability.

责备,谴责:对过失或错误的责任的状态;应受谴责的行为

(2)Censure; condemnation.

责备,责怪

习惯用语


to blame

(1)Deserving censure; at fault.

谴责:应受谴责的;有过错的

(2)Being the cause or source of something:

起因是:是…起因或某事的根源的:

A freak storm was to blame for the power outage.

停电的起因是一场特大暴风雪

语源


(1)Middle English blamen

中古英语 blamen

(2)from Old French blasmer, blamer

源自 古法语 blasmer, blamer

(3)from Vulgar Latin *blast?3re}

源自 俗拉丁语 *blast?3re}

(4)alteration of Late Latin blasph?3re} [to reproach] * see blaspheme

后期拉丁语 blasph?3re的变化} [责备,指责] *参见 blaspheme

参考词汇


(1)blamefaultguilt

(2)These nouns are compared in the sense of responsibility for an offense.

可以从对错误负有的责任这一意义比较这些名词。

(3)Blame stresses censure or punishment for a lapse or misdeed for which one is held accountable:

Blame 强调对某种可以解释的失误或不良行为的谴责或惩罚:

The police laid the blame for the accident squarely on the driver's shoulders.

警方公正地把事故的责任归于司机。

(4)Fault is culpability for causing or failing to prevent the occurrence of something detrimental:

Fault 是指引起或没能阻止某有害事件发生而应承担的责任:

The student failed the examination, but not through any fault of his teacher.

这个学生考试不及格,但不是由于老师的过失。

(5)Guilt applies to serious, willful breaches of conduct and stresses moral culpability:

Guilt 适用于情节严重、故意的不良行为并强调道德上的过失:

The case was dismissed because the prosecution did not have sufficient evidence of the defendant's guilt. See also Synonyms at criticize

案子被撤消了,因为指控对被告罪行没有足够的证据 参见同义词 criticize
